Question:

Can tinplate be used for household appliances?

Answer:

Yes, tinplate can be used for household appliances. Tinplate is a type of steel coated with a thin layer of tin, which provides corrosion resistance and makes it suitable for various applications including household appliances such as cans, containers, and even electrical components.
